Helios HR is supporting our client, Superior Paving, in their search for a Senior Payroll Specialist. The Senior Payroll Specialist will ensure hardworking, field-based crews are paid accurately and on time. In a company built on excellence and strong relationships, attention to detail and payroll expertise will help fuel the people who keep the roads moving forward, every single day. The Senior Payroll Specialist will be proficient in processing weekly payroll using UKG Ready and have a strong understanding of garnishment calculations, as well as state and federal payroll tax processing. This role is crucial in ensuring that our employees are paid accurately and on time while maintaining compliance with all relevant regulations. Key Responsibilities Process weekly payroll for multi-state employees, ensuring accuracy and timeliness. Reconcile payroll discrepancies as needed. Maintain accurate payroll records to ensure compliance with government regulations. Calculate and process garnishments, levies, child support, and other wage deductions Prepare and process state and federal payroll tax filings Stay up-to-date with changes in tax regulations to ensure compliance Assist with quarterly and annual tax filings, including W-2 and 1099 forms. Generate and analyze payroll reports for management review. Conduct regular audits of payroll data to ensure accuracy Assist with year-end payroll activities, including reconciliations and audits. Collaborate Finance to identify opportunities for improving payroll processes Participate in system upgrades, testing, and implementation of new features in UKG Ready. Qualifications Bachelor’s degree in Accounting, Finance, or related field preferred Minimum of 5-7 years of payroll processing experience, with a focus on multi-state payroll. Proficiency in using UKG Ready (formerly Kronos Workforce Ready) required Excellent attention to detail and strong analytical skills. Ability to handle confidential information with discretion and integrity. Strong communication skills, both verbal and written Certification as a Certified Payroll Professional (CPP) is a plus. Candidates must be available to work on-site, five days a week, as this is a position that requires daily in-office attendance.
